Ya! the title is correct, I am talking of the efficient way to use a double click, just as you perform normal double click (with left mouse key), you can put the double right click to a good use. Let’s see how?

Here comes a new software named as “Click Zap” which enables us to assign a action to the double right click on native Windows XP. Click Zap helps to establish following actions to the mouse’s right double click.

List of actions:Click Zap Action List

  • Lock Computer
  • Log Off Computer
  • Shutdown Computer
  • Minimize Active Window
  • Minimize All Windows
  • Close Active Window
  • Close All Windows
  • Mute Sound

ClickZap calls the double right click activity as multi-right click, so be careful while setting the actions.

Once you download (<- direct download link) the ClickZap, it sets the “Lock Computer as a default action, but can later change it to suit your needs. As for my personal need I would prefer to set action as minimize active window or “mute sound” in case i don’t have easy access to speakers.

Although ClickZap stand as great tool to put mouse to full use, but it would be better if you can think of using third mouse button (wheel or middle button) also to this sort of better use.
